Output 643a3c012817e076e3c8a9ec335c51aada90b2b2cb9e6383a48480bce61a3623:1

value
17718120204
script pubkey
OP_0 OP_PUSHBYTES_20 ed96cbfc39b718f20adae4ee3c616893896c5bf9
address
ltc1qaktvhlpekuv0yzk6unhrcctgjwykckleegn4ky
transaction
643a3c012817e076e3c8a9ec335c51aada90b2b2cb9e6383a48480bce61a3623
spent
true